LaSalle St – 8th Floor, Room 805 Presented by USDOT Office of Small Business - Great Lakes Region at IHCC Did you know that the USDOT and other transportation agencies buy goods and services from all types of small businesses? Come and learn how you can position your business to obtain upcoming transportation procurement opportunities like the Chicago Transit Authority’s $2.1 billion first phase of the Red and Purple Modernization Program, the Illinois Tollway’s 15-year, $12 billion construction program and O’Hare International Airport's $8.5 billion expansion project. We will discuss free resources to help you with obtaining bonding, SBA loans and creative financing options to accelerate the growth of your business.
